Gloucester Museum and Archives
Gloucester Museum and Archives is a museum in Ottawa, Ontario which is located on Bank Street. Gloucester Museum and Archives is situated nearby to the community center Gloucester South Seniors Centre, as well as near Ottawa Fire Station 32.Places of Interest Nearby

Leitrim
Neighborhood
Leitrim is a dispersed rural community in the South Gloucester section of Ottawa, Ontario, Canada, and is named for the Irish County Leitrim. The area comprises the rapidly growing Findlay Creek suburban neighbourhood.
Kempark
Neighborhood
Kempark is a community in Gloucester-Southgate Ward in the south end of Ottawa, Ontario, Canada. Prior to amalgamation in 2001, it located in City of Gloucester.
